高压去毛刺清洗机的工作原理和特点

来源:http://www.sinokohl.com/ 时间: 2025-04-12 浏览次数: 0

工作原理

Working principle

通过动力装置使高压柱塞泵产生高压水,高压水通过精密控制的喷嘴系统喷射而出,形成高速射流。当高速射流冲击到工件表面时,如果壁面存在毛刺,毛刺根部将产生较大的局部应力,从而使毛刺在射流冲击作用下从工件本体上脱落,达到去毛刺的目的。同时,高压水射流也能将工件表面的污垢剥离、冲走,实现清洗功能。此外,一些高压去毛刺清洗机还可能配备数控系统、自动清洗系统、机器视觉及数字图像处理技术等,以实现高精度的孔位探测、导引控制和自动化操作。

The high-pressure plunger pump generates high-pressure water through a power device, and the high-pressure water is sprayed out through a precisely controlled nozzle system, forming a high-speed jet. When the high-speed jet impacts the surface of the workpiece, if there are burrs on the wall, significant local stress will be generated at the root of the burrs, causing them to detach from the workpiece body under the impact of the jet, achieving the purpose of deburring. At the same time, high-pressure water jet can also peel off and wash away dirt on the surface of the workpiece, achieving cleaning function. In addition, some high-pressure deburring cleaning machines may also be equipped with CNC systems, automatic cleaning systems, machine vision, and digital image processing technologies to achieve high-precision hole detection, guidance control, and automated operation.

特点

characteristic

高效精准:能在短时间内快速去除毛刺,水射流可覆盖工件的内腔、盲孔等复杂结构,确保毛刺被彻底清除。并且可以通过调节压力与流量,在精准去除毛刺的同时保护工件表面光洁度。

Efficient and precise: It can quickly remove burrs in a short period of time, and the water jet can cover complex structures such as the inner cavity and blind holes of the workpiece, ensuring that burrs are completely removed. And it can protect the surface smoothness of the workpiece while accurately removing burrs by adjusting the pressure and flow rate.

绿色环保:仅以水为介质,无需添加化学药剂,无有毒废液排放,符合环保标准。同时配备高效过滤装置,水资源重复利用率高,综合用水成本低,还避免了粉尘危害,改善车间环境。

Green and environmentally friendly: Only using water as the medium, no need to add chemical agents, no toxic waste liquid discharge, in compliance with environmental standards. At the same time, it is equipped with an efficient filtration device, which has a high reuse rate of water resources, low comprehensive water costs, and avoids dust hazards, improving the workshop environment.

智能化控制:集成 PLC 智能控制系统与多轴联动机械臂,可根据不同工件材质、毛刺特性一键设定压力、角度等参数,实时反馈清洗数据并自动生成质量报告,便于追溯与工艺优化,还能无缝对接自动化产线,实现无人化生产。

Intelligent control: Integrated with PLC intelligent control system and multi axis linkage robotic arm, pressure, angle and other parameters can be set with one click according to different workpiece materials and burr characteristics. Real time feedback of cleaning data and automatic generation of quality reports are provided for easy traceability and process optimization. It can also seamlessly connect with automated production lines to achieve unmanned production.

维护成本低:核心部件采用耐磨陶瓷材质,使用寿命延长,故障率低。同时,变频驱动技术降低了电能消耗,综合能效比传统设备提升。

Low maintenance cost: The core components are made of wear-resistant ceramic material, which extends the service life and has a low failure rate. At the same time, variable frequency drive technology reduces energy consumption and improves overall energy efficiency compared to traditional equipment.
